Agri sector facing crisis, claims BJP
Vijayawada, Feb 20 (UNI) The Agriculture Sector is facing a crisis and there is a great threat to the food security of the country, claimed former BJP president M Venkaiah Naidu today.
Addressing the valedictory of the two-day State Executive and Council meeting here, Mr Naidu blamed the Congress Government's policies for farmers changing profession ultimately affecting the agriculture sector with the cultivable land reducing every year.
Farmers who were not getting minimum support price for the produce and unable to bear the debts were committing suicide. During the BJP-led NDA Rule, the country was exporting foodgrains whereas under the UPA Government, India was going for imports.
If the government continued to neglect agriculture, the sector will be thrown into severe crisis, he said while demanding the implementation of the Swaminathan Committee Recommendations.
Mr Naidu said the Congress Government failed to control prices of almost all the commodities, including pulses, cement, petrol and diesel. Also, no new employment opportunities were created.
Claiming that the BJP was not opposing the Special Economic Zones (SEZs), Mr Naidu said the party only opposed the acquisition of agriculture lands for the purpose.
The Congress Government did not have a clear cut stand on ISI and LTTE activities and naxal violence, he claimed.
Hundreds of people were killed in terrorism and violence, he claimed while stressing on the need to re-introduce POTA.
He also blamed the Centre for delaying the hanging of Afzal Guru, the main accused in Parliament Attack Case.
Mr Naidu said if the be BJP is voted to power in the next elections, top priority would be given to agriculture sector and minimum support price paid for all crops. Besides, it will stop reservation on religious basis, control religious conversions and introduce common civil code.
